Phoenix warmth changes the calculus
The Valley's climate punishes equipment. We ask cooling and heating systems to lug 110 to 118 levels of mid-day warm for months, after that take a breath with dust from haboobs and gale microbursts. Roof covering temperatures can run 20 to 40 degrees hotter than the air, so an outside system may be dropping heat into air that feels like it comes from an oven. That warm load pushes compressors to the side. Any type of weakness, from a low capacitor to a tiny refrigerant leak, ends up being a major failure at 4 p.m. In July. This is why heating and cooling repair service calls spike by a factor of 4 in between May and August for every heating and cooling company in the region, and why one of the most expensive element has a tendency to be the one doing one of the most brutal work.
The compressor, and why it tops the cost chart
Think of the compressor as the air conditioning's heart. It pressurizes refrigerant and relocates heat from your home to the outdoors. In older, solitary stage devices, the compressor is a straightforward electric motor with a piston or scroll collection. In newer, high effectiveness systems, you see 2 stage or inverter driven compressors that regulate speed and pressure. Those innovative compressors draw power more with dignity and run quieter, yet they are much more complicated and expensive.
When a compressor stops working in Phoenix metro, components alone can run 1,500 to 3,500 bucks for usual single stage models, and 3,000 to 5,500 dollars for inverter compressors connected to exclusive control panel. Include labor, cooling agent, and recuperation or evacuation work, and the installed rate to replace a negative compressor generally lands in the 2,800 to 7,500 dollar variety. The variety depends on the brand name, cooling agent kind, warranty standing, and whether your unit is a split system on the side of your house or a roof bundle requiring crane time.
This is why, when you ask the most costly line on a repair ticket for a significant failure, the answer is the compressor typically. It is the cost of the part, the trouble of the task, and the danger entailed. On a 115 degree day, drawing a compressor out of a roof closet and brazing in a brand-new one, then drawing a deep vacuum cleaner and billing specifically, is just one of one of the most demanding jobs in a/c repair.
When the "most pricey part" comes to be the whole exterior unit
In Phoenix az, there is a twist. Lots of homes and little commercial spaces use packaged rooftop systems, especially in older communities and strip facilities. A packaged unit contains the compressor, condenser coil, blower, and manages in a solitary closet. If the compressor stops working and the system is out of warranty, home owners usually select to change the whole package as opposed to the compressor alone. Reasons include the age of the warmth exchanger, UV damages to wiring and insulation, and performance upgrades that bring real savings.
A roof changeout adds costs you do not see on a ground level split system. There is crane time to raise the unit, web traffic control if the road have to be partially closed, a visual adapter to fit the brand-new cupboard to the old roof aesthetic, and often duct transitions or electric upgrades to meet code. Those items can add 1,200 to 3,500 bucks to a task that or else might be an uncomplicated like for like swap on a slab. Consequently, one of the most expensive "part" on the proposal sheet becomes the outdoor unit itself, not just the compressor inside it. Fully set up roof bundles generally range from 9,000 to 18,000 dollars for common capacities, and extra for huge homes or high performance variable speed models.
Why compressors fail more often here
We track failure creates across our hvac solutions in Phoenix metro. Year after year, the same perpetrators show up.
Heat saturation. Compressors run hotter under high ambient problems. Oil breaks down quicker, electrical windings see even more stress, and thermal overloads journey a lot more quickly. A little limitation in the metering gadget that would certainly be a hassle in San Diego can burn a winding in Phoenix.
Voltage changes. Brownouts and short period voltage dips, especially in older neighborhoods throughout optimal load, can press a compressor into a delayed or locked rotor condition. That gets too hot windings. We suggest difficult begin sets just when required and sized appropriately. The wrong kit can develop a bigger trouble than it solves.
Dust and airflow restrictions. Dirt and cottonwood fluff clog condenser fins. Airflow drops, head stress climbs, and the compressor chefs. We have seen brand-new systems fail within 3 seasons because no person washed the coil.
Refrigerant issues. Low fee from a leak, overcharge from a well implying but rushed tech, or contamination from a careless repair service can all drive a compressor out of its safe operating envelope. R‑22 legacy systems are particularly in danger because several have been topped off repetitively. Once the oil is acidified, failure refers time.
Poor installment. A system can look cool and still be wrong. Discharge lines without correct oil return slope, line establishes as well tiny for the tonnage, or a vacuum that never got to a real 500 microns, all shorten compressor life.
A field story that clarifies the math
Last July, we took a heating and cooling repair phone call from a household in Maryvale with a 12 year old 4 heap roof heatpump. No air conditioning, 109 outside, indoor temperature 88 and climbing. Static pressure looked affordable, coil tidy, blower solid. Pressures were high, subcooling unpredictable. The compressor was drawing secured rotor amps on start, after that tripping. We validated capacitor values, checked the contactor, and inspected voltage under tons. The compressor insulation examined to ground at borderline values. The supplier's service warranty had expired. The quote for a compressor modification, including crane, recovery, and a new filter drier with a proper discharge, came to simply under 4,200 bucks. The quote for a full rooftop replacement with a mid rate 2 phase model, curb adapter, and permit was 12,600.
They asked the best question. Will I be back here paying once again if another thing goes? We strolled them with the staying life of the blower electric motor, the board, the turning around valve that was starting to stick, and the cabinet insulation that had actually collapsed. They selected the full substitute, partially for power savings, partially to quit gambling every summer season weekend break. Their APS bills stopped by approximately 15 percent, which follows going from a weary 10 SEER matching to a new SEER2 14.3 package in a well secured home.

We likewise look at the refrigerant. If you get on an R‑22 system, even a successful compressor swap leaves you with a cooling agent that is costly and shrinking in accessibility. If the interior coil is R‑22 only and the outdoor unit is R‑410A or R‑454B qualified, compatibility becomes a concern. In those cases, placing lots of money right into a compressor is frequently tossing excellent cash after bad.
The other pricey components you ought to know
The compressor obtains the headings, yet a couple of other parts have high price tags in Phoenix.
The evaporator coil. Inside the air handler or furnace cupboard, this coil can leak from formicary corrosion or physical damage. Changing it is labor heavy. A coil modification on a split system typically lands between 1,400 and 3,200 dollars installed, depending on access and refrigerant. In dusty attics, the coil's insulation and drain pans can likewise require attention, adding to cost.
The condenser coil. On numerous modern devices, the coil twists around the cabinet in a solitary serpentine. If a section is squashed by windblown particles or a stress washing machine rips fins, repair service might not be feasible. A brand-new coil can cost as long as a third to half the price of a complete condenser. That fact pushes several house owners towards replacing the whole outdoor device, not just the coil.
Variable rate blower electric motors and control boards. ECM electric motors and proprietary boards that speak with inverter compressors carry greater components prices. A variable speed indoor electric motor set up can run 900 to 1,800 dollars. A communicating control board, if lightning or a surge takes it out, can be similar. While not as costly as a compressor, they are not tiny tickets.
Ductwork and plenums. In Phoenix metro attic rooms, ducts bake. Joints stop working, insulation slides, and air flow experiences. Changing a few runs or rebuilding a plenum to heal warm rooms is not a solitary component cost, however it appears on the very same billing. In genuine terms, airflow repairs add 800 to 3,000 bucks to several bigger replacements, and they are frequently the distinction in between a system that fulfills its SEER theoretically and one that supplies convenience at 4 p.m.
What we search for during a compressor diagnosis
An honest heating and cooling business must spend more time detecting than marketing. We document the electrical side initially. That indicates begin and run capacitors under load, contactor condition, cable temperature level, and voltage droop at start. We relocate to refrigerant information with superheat and subcooling, then compare those to target values for the tools. Temperature split across the coil tells us the indoor side story. Amp make use of the compressor versus nameplate values is an additional check. When we think acid in the oil, we check it. If we discover contamination, we explain the steps required, including filter driers and a complete evacuation with a micron gauge. We take photos. We reveal you the megohm analysis to ground. A compressor quote without this level of detail is a hunch, and guesses often tend to set you back more later.

Efficiency choices that influence long term costs
The cheapest fixing is not constantly the lowest expense over 5 years. In Phoenix az, devices that can pull down interior temps throughout optimal warm without running just for hours has worth. 2 stage compressors provide a great happy medium. They take care of most of the day in reduced stage, then shift right into high when the attic and west encountering wall surfaces are emitting heat. Inverter systems take that additionally, regulating to match load and typically holding tighter humidity control.
We see real distinctions in comfort. A 16 SEER2 2 phase unit, effectively sized with tidy air ducts, frequently cuts peak power by 15 to 25 percent versus a 12 to 13 SEER2 solitary phase it changes. An inverter can conserve even more and run quieter, but it brings higher component and repair service prices. If you prepare to remain in the home for seven or even more years, and you have qualified heating and cooling solutions to keep it, the financial investment can make sense. If you are flipping a rental or you move often, a strong single stage or two phase might be smarter.
Heat pump or gas heating system pairing for Phoenix az homes
Heat pumps have actually won a great deal of ground in the Valley. Winters are light, so a heat pump manages most heating days without electric strip heat. If your home has gas solution, a dual gas system pairs a heatpump with a gas heater for cooler nights and solid warm at reduced operating expense. The option affects what stops working and what costs money later on. Heatpump add a turning around valve, defrost board, and much more compressor hours per year. A gas furnace adds a warm exchanger and burning controls. We look at your prices with APS or SRP, your ductwork, and your roof room prior to advising a path. Both can be trusted when mounted right.

Maintenance that in fact extends compressor life
Skip the fluff. The things that settle in our environment are simple. Keep condenser coils clean. We wash from the inside out with reduced pressure water and a coil risk-free cleaner, not a stress washer that folds up fins. Change air filters promptly to secure the evaporator coil and keep fixed stress in range. Check capacitors every spring under tons, not just with a bench meter. Verify refrigerant charge by superheat and subcooling, not by guesswork. Log numbers year over year, due to the fact that trends reveal concerns that check out can not. If you get on an inverter system, maintain the control panel compartments tidy and secured. Dirt kills electronic devices slowly.

Warranties, refunds, and timing the work
Most significant brand names lug a 10 year components warranty when registered. Labor is typically 1 to 3 years unless you buy a prolonged strategy. If your compressor falls short inside the parts window, your biggest cost ends up being labor, cooling agent, and incidentals. That can turn a 4,500 buck work right into a 1,600 to 2,500 dollar job. Maintain your documentation and serial numbers handy. We additionally inspect APS and SRP programs. Refunds change, but high effectiveness replacements and smart thermostats commonly get approved for moderate credit ratings that counter component of the project.
Timing matters. The same roof crane that costs 600 dollars in October can cost 1,200 in July when reserved on brief notification. If your system is limping along in April, do yourself a favor and timetable work prior to the initial 105 level stretch. You will have a lot more options and less downtime.

A short price reality check for Phoenix metro homeowners
A compressor replacement on a ground installed split system: generally 2,800 to 5,000 dollars installed.
A compressor replacement on a rooftop package with crane and appropriate emptying: generally 4,000 to 7,500 dollars installed.
A complete exterior device swap for a split system, keeping the interior coil if compatible and clean: typically 5,500 to 10,500 dollars, with efficiency, brand name, and line established size influencing price.
A full packaged rooftop replacement with visual work: frequently 9,000 to 18,000 dollars.
An interior evaporator coil substitute: commonly 1,400 to 3,200 dollars.
These are real life varies we see throughout our heating and cooling solutions. Your home's specifics can turn numbers up or down, yet the loved one order seldom alters. The compressor is the heavyweight, and rooftop logistics can turn the entire unit right into the price champion.
